To Clean White Flannel.

To clear stains on white flannel or blankets apply a little pure glycerin mixed with the yolk of an egg. Allow this to remain for an hour and then wash in a lather made of boiled soap. All woolens should be washed tn soap that has been dissolved by boiling. It is best to use rainwater if possible. Soil For House Plants. The one thing needed for the successfol growth of house plants as well as outdoor plants is good soil. A soil that la composed of three parts fibrous garden soil, one part sand and one part well rotted manure, all well mixed, will prove a good mixture for many of the plants suitable for house culture.
